The second chapter of Capcom's space adventure is set on the same E.D.N III planet as the original, but now the snow has slowly started to melt away, leaving a world of jungles and other such environments for gamers to explore, as well as giving rise to new dangers...
When Lost Planet first hit the videogame world just over two years ago, it wowed us with some sparkling visuals, confused some with its quirkiness, and hooked many more on its unique brand of multiplayer combat. The sequel is not going to miss a beat in any of those departments. In fact, it's going to push the formula to the limit by offering up four player co-op, new customization options, bigger Akrid bug battles, and much, much more. We recently sat through a guided demo provided by the game's producer, Jun Takeuchi, to get our first look at the sequel in motion. Though this sequel has a distinct Lost Planet feel, it is going through somewhat of a radical shift in focus. The first game was a single-player, character driven story. Capcom even went so far as to license the likeness of a Japanese TV star for the main character, Wayne, for a twisted story of survival on a frozen, bug-infested planet.
